With the winter transfer window just around the corner, Real Madrid scouts are already hard at work trying to find the next gem in European football.

Although after Endrick’s loan move to Lyon, Los Blancos are not expected to make any more moves in the January transfer market, that hasn’t stopped them from monitoring a few young talents across Europe.


OneFootball Videos


One of the players Real Madrid are scouting closely is Honest Ahanor, a defensive prodigy from Atalanta.

The next big thing in Serie A?

According to Defensa Central, Real Madrid have sent scouts to keep a close eye on Ahanor, who, at just 17, has become a first-team component at Atalanta.

A centre-back by trade, Ahanor has impressed onlookers with his composure, speed and agility at the back, leading many to call him the next big defensive prodigy in Italy.

At just 17, Ahanor has already featured in 13 competitive matches for Atalanta. It appears he has vindicated the club’s decision to spend €17 million on a player who had made just six competitive appearances for his previous club, Genoa.

How will Ahanor fit into Real Madrid?

Apart from his age and potential, what makes Ahanor an exciting prospect for Real Madrid is the versatility he offers at the back.

The youngster is capable of operating as a centre-back as well as a full-back, making him an ideal addition to a Real Madrid defence that has lacked depth in recent years.

Furthermore, with Antonio Rudiger and David Alaba’s contracts expiring soon, Ahanor could prove to be an excellent long-term investment for Los Blancos.

That being said, Ahanor has just moved to Atalanta for a fortune and it is unlikely the club would want to part ways with the player anytime soon, especially given that his contract doesn’t expire until 2028.
